    In this episode of Photonics Hot List:

    A team from SLAC National Accelerator Laboratory is now on track to explore atomic-scale ultrafast phenomena with unprecedented precision, thanks to some high-energy upgrades to the Linac Coherent Light Source.

    Microstructured hollow-core optical fibers created by researchers at the University of Bath’s Centre for Photonics and Photonic Materials are poised to better handle the advanced data transfer requirements of quantum computing.

    With a $3.5 million follow-on order in hand, LightPath Technologies is now working on advancements—specifically, germanium-free infrared optics—for the military’s F-35 combat aircraft program.
